Natalie’s internal linking tips:

  • Monitor internal link changes by using site crawls
  • Make changes as soon as you can
  • Do not put all of your navigation links in the footer!
  • Ensure your anchor text isn’t spammy
  • Use business cases to get client/stakeholder buy-in
  • Work alongside other teams if needed
  • Don’t overdo it with on-page links
  • Use markup to enrich specific internal links (eg breadcrumb)
  • Keyword research and Google Analytics are invaluable resources that are often neglected with internal linking
  • When you acquire new links from Digital PR and link building, make sure that the link sources have internal links to relevant pages
